On average across the year,
yes, San Pedro, California is hotter than
Woodland, California
.
San Pedro, California has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F and Woodland, California has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F.
San Pedro, California's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F, which is not hotter than Woodland, California's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 36°C/97°F).
On average across the year, no, San Pedro, California is not colder than Woodland, California . San Pedro, California has an average minimum temperature of 14°C/57°F and Woodland, California has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F.
On average across the year,
no, San Pedro, California has less rain than
Woodland, California. San Pedro, California has an average annual rainfall of 268mm and Woodland, California has an average annual rainfall of 598mm.
San Pedro, California's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 67mm, which is drier than Woodland, California's wettest month (January, with an average monthly rainfall of 127mm).
